Many years ago I worked for a flooring contractor. He had a favorite mug and a favorite pen and you’d better not touch either one if you knew what was good for you. One day when I arrived at work things were unusually quiet - everyone was in their office with the door closed. I went into the break room to check out the donut situation and there on the counter was John’s mug with its handle lying next to it. I too made a beeline for my own office and closed the door. What an up roar followed!
So many of us start our day with a cup of coffee in our favorite mug. Or we keep our favorite mug on our desk at work and use it throughout the day. But what makes a mug a favorite mug? Why do we reach for a particular one when we open the cupboard?
Over the years I’ve watched many people choose a mug. They try out the handle for just the right fit, they balance the weight of it by kind of shaking it up and down and then they put both hands around it and bring it close to their heart. Why do we do these things? I think it has to do with handmade objects connecting us as humans. There is something very special about holding something that has been shaped with care, by hand – you can almost feel where the maker’s fingers were on the piece, where they applied pressure, where they smoothed out an edge, how they beveled a curve.
When you think about it, a mug is a pretty intimate object; we put it against our lips, which is a very personal way to touch something. When we hold a mug close to our heart, it’s almost like the warm mug is providing some sort of comfort - in addition to holding our beverage it's giving us a hug.
I hope all my mugs become chosen favorites. I try to make them comfortable to hold, well balanced and often I add a little frog companion to keep you company and make you smile. Having a mug made by hand with care and attention and love connects us together. I think that is quite an achievement for a simple coffee mug.
